Hybrid construction machine

The hybrid construction machine includes an engine 11, an electric motor/generator 14, a hydraulic pump unit 17, an electricity storage device 16, an inverter 15, a temperature regulator (16D or 16E), and a hybrid control unit 22. The hybrid control unit 22 executes at least one of first control for controlling a warming-up battery temperature regulator 16D so that it increases a temperature of the electricity storage device 16, second control for controlling the inverter 15 so that it reduces the power output from the inverter 15, and third control for controlling a pump capacity control unit 21 so that it reduces the flow rate of a hydraulic fluid delivered from the hydraulic pump unit 17, according to a charge/discharge history of the electricity storage device 16.

Shopping Cart and Associated Systems and Methods

Exemplary embodiments are generally directed to shopping carts and associated systems and methods. Exemplary embodiments of the shopping cart include a shopping cart body and a plurality of wheels supporting the shopping cart body. Exemplary embodiments of the shopping cart include a receiver configured to detect a position of the shopping cart relative to a range of a network or an area defined by a geo-fence. Exemplary embodiments of the shopping cart include an electromagnetic generator operatively coupled to at least one of the plurality of wheels. A resistive load can be selectively connected between an input and an output of the electromagnetic generator to restrict rotation of the at least one of the plurality of wheels as the position of the shopping cart detected by the receiver varies between within or outside of the range of the network or the area defined by the geo-fence.

ELECTRIC OR HYBRID ELECTRIC VEHICLE HAVING MULTIPLE DRIVE UNITS ARRANGED IN SEPARATE PARTS OF THE VEHICLE
20170217303 · 2017-08-03 · ·

An articulated vehicle having at least two vehicle parts which are connected to and articulated relative to each other is provided. The vehicle includes a front vehicle part and at least one rear vehicle part arranged behind the front vehicle part with respect to a longitudinal direction of the vehicle. The front vehicle part has a first drive unit including at least an electric motor and a first energy storage system; and at least one rear vehicle part has a drive unit including at least an electric motor and an energy storage system. Each rear vehicle part includes an individual electrical system that is galvanically isolated from the front vehicle part and from each other at least under normal driving conditions.

Hybrid powertrain and method for controlling the same
09815453 · 2017-11-14 · ·

A hybrid powertrain and a method for controlling the powertrain are provided to convert an EV mode, a power slit mode, and a parallel mode based on a driving state. The powertrain includes an input shaft connected to an engine and first and second motors/generators installed within a transmission housing. A planetary gear set is installed on an input shaft and includes a combination of a sun gear, a planetary carrier, and a ring gear. A first output gear is connected to the second motor/generator and a second output gear is connected to the planetary carrier of the planetary gear set. A rotation restraint mechanism restricts a rotation of the input shaft. An overdrive brake is connected to the sun gear of the planetary gear set or the first motor/generator. An output shaft is supplied with power through the first and second output gears.
